Understanding Water Hardness: Testing Methods & Measurement Scales

Water hardness remains one of the most misunderstood aspects of home water quality, yet it affects everything from the lifespan of your appliances to how clean your clothes get.

first image
Hard water isn't just a plumbing issue—it's silently compromising your appliances, laundry, and water heater efficiency daily.

We measure hardness in grains per gallon (GPG) or parts per million (PPM), with classifications ranging from soft (below 1 GPG) to extremely hard (exceeding 10.5 GPG). Indiana residents typically face hardness levels between 15-30 GPG due to high mineral content, primarily calcium and magnesium.

Don't rely solely on utility reports for accurate hardness data. We've found they often lack specific measurements vital for proper water softener sizing.

Instead, invest in an in-home test kit for precise readings. Regular testing isn't just good practice—it's essential for optimizing your water softener's performance and protecting your plumbing system from costly mineral buildup.

How Water Hardness Impacts Long-Term Softener Performance

When selecting a water softener for your home, understanding the direct relationship between hardness levels and system performance becomes critical for long-term satisfaction.

We've found that properly sized systems based on accurate GPG measurements prevent costly operational inefficiencies.

Consider this: a household using 300 gallons daily with 10 GPG hardness needs to process 3,000 grains daily. An undersized system will regenerate too frequently, wasting salt and water while increasing your operational costs.

We can't overstate the importance of regular hardness monitoring.

Mineral content fluctuations can force your system to work harder or operate unnecessarily, affecting both performance and budget.

Calculating the Right Softener Capacity Based on Your Water Profile

Three essential steps must be taken to calculate your ideal water softener capacity, making certain you don't waste money on an oversized unit or struggle with an underpowered system. First, determine your daily water consumption by multiplying household members by 75 gallons each. Second, test your water hardness in GPG, which in Indiana typically ranges from 15-30. Finally, multiply these values to find your daily softening requirement.

Household Size Daily Usage (gal) At 20 GPG Hardness
2 people 150 3,000 grains
4 people 300 6,000 grains
6 people 450 9,000 grains

We recommend adding a 20-30% buffer to your calculation for unexpected usage spikes. This makes certain your system—whether 24,000 or 48,000 grain capacity—operates efficiently without premature regeneration cycles.

Hidden Costs of Undersized Systems in Hard Water Areas

Many homeowners focus solely on the upfront price tag when purchasing a water softener, overlooking the substantial long-term expenses that an undersized system can incur.

When your softener lacks proper capacity for your water hardness level, the financial impact compounds quickly.

We've identified these critical hidden costs:

  1. 30-50% higher annual salt expenses due to excessive regeneration cycles that still fail to adequately treat your water.
  2. 10-25% increase in utility bills as appliances struggle to function efficiently with limescale buildup.
  3. Up to 80% more spending on soaps and detergents as they lose effectiveness in partially softened water.

The most devastating consequence?

Potential plumbing system failure requiring thousands in emergency repairs—a steep price for what initially seemed like a budget-conscious decision.

Balancing Initial Investment vs. Operational Expenses in Different Hardness Zones

Water hardness levels directly impact both your initial investment and long-term operational expenses when choosing a water softener system. In areas with extremely hard water (above 10.5 GPG), you'll need larger, more robust systems that require higher upfront costs but protect your home from costly plumbing repairs and appliance replacements.

We've found that analyzing your specific hardness zone helps optimize your investment:

Hardness Level Initial Investment Annual Operational Costs Long-Term Value
Soft (<3 GPG) Lower ($600-900) $60-100 Good
Moderate (3-7) Medium ($900-1,200) $80-150 Better
Hard (7-10.5) High ($1,200-1,800) $100-200 Excellent
Very Hard (>10.5) Premium ($1,800+) $200-300 Superior

Frequently Asked Questions

What Hardness Should You Set Your Water Softener At?

We'll set our water softener to match our measured GPG hardness level, adding 5 GPG for each 1 ppm of iron present to guarantee maximum performance and prevent scale buildup.

Why Is Water Hardness Important in Water Treatment?

We consider water hardness essential in treatment because it determines our system's capacity requirements, affects maintenance frequency, and impacts equipment longevity. It's the foundation for creating efficient, cost-effective water solutions.

Does Water Hardness Really Matter?

Yes, water hardness absolutely matters! We've seen how it affects everything from your softener's efficiency to your long-term budget, potentially costing you thousands in premature system replacements.

What Is the Role of a Water Softener With Respect to Water Hardness?

We remove calcium and magnesium minerals from hard water through our water softener's ion exchange process. It's specifically designed to tackle your water's hardness level, preventing scale buildup in your plumbing and appliances.
